Summary
Makes corrections to provisions related to income tax subtraction for senior medical expenses, tax treatment of domestic international sales corporations and distribution of proceeds from cigarette tax. Modifies conditions for optional reduced rates of personal income tax on nonpassive income attributable to partnership or S corporation to align material participation requirement with federal provision. States that provision allowing Department of Revenue to waive penalty or interest on underpayment or underreporting of taxes attributable to retroactive application of legislation applies to immediate tax year. Provides that additional personal exemption credits allowed for child with disability or for taxpayer with severe disability are not phased out or eliminated based on income. Applies to tax years beginning on or after January 1, 2013. Retroactively reinstates reciprocal tax exemptions applicable to interstate bridges. Modifies terminology relating to exemption from taxable income of compensation paid to nonresidents for duties performed on vessels. Provides that penalties for failure to substantiate reports required to be made to Department of Revenue apply per individual federal form W-2. Applies to tax years beginning on or after January 1, 2014. Provides that income tax assessment imposed on residents of county affected by fiscal emergency, if imposed on nonresident, shall be prorated according to provisions applicable to personal income tax. Takes effect on 91st day following adjournment sine die.
